Tuticorin-Colombo ferry service after TN elections: Vasan

Ramanathapuram: Congress leader and Union Minister for Shipping G K Vasan on Wednesday assured that the Tuticorin-Colombo Passenger Ferry Service would begin after the April 13 Tamil Nadu Assembly elections.

Talking to reporters at Keelakarai near here, he said the survey for resuming Rameswaram-Talaimannar passenger ferry service had also been completed, and the service would commence soon.

Later addressing election meetings in the district, Vasan said if the governments at the Centre and State had cordial relations, it would be easy to implement various schemes and help in the economic development of the state.

Referring to the poll promises of Tamil Nadu Chief Minister M Karunanidhi, Vasan said he had proved his credibility by implementing all the electoral promises he had made in 2006, such as the providing rice for one rupee.

Speaking on the measures taken by the UPA government for the welfare of minorities, the Congress leader said it had allocated Rs 2,850 crore for Minority welfare.

The educational assistance to the minority students had benefitted 25 lakh students, Vasan claimed, adding the government had allocated Rs 1,000 crore for the National Minorities Development fund.

Ninety districts in the country had received a special fund of Rs 2,343 crore for development, he said.

Vasan said if people were told about the schemes implemented by the government, they would vote for the ruling party.
